When you have committed to SEO, your website’s up, you’ve got your keyword technique all set to go, and it’s time to start building link building back to your site… you’re confronted by the question: should I execute this myself, or allow somebody do the work for me? Let us take a look at the advantages and disadvantages of your possibilities, and then decide which method is best suited for you.

DIY Linking:

Pro’s:

    Control. You’ve got control on every link position.

    Cost. If you’re building the link development on your own, the cost is quite minimal.

    Networking. When you are building links, you’re likely to meet others within your industry. Those relationships can lead to much more than straightforward link building.

    Flexibility. If you see an item no longer working, you could change easily because you aren’t currently totally devoted to it.

Con’s

    Time. Link building is a time consuming procedure, and could take away from probably more important tasks.

    Learning Curve. There is a learning curve for doing certain things correctly so that you maximize the work you need to do.

    Quantity. If you’re a novice and not familiar with automating, you will not be able to achieve the quantity of links you could if you were to simple pay somebody that knows exactly what they’re doing.

    Variety. Most people who do their own link building typically get stuck doing things a certain way which ultimately could cause a huge lag in ranking speed.

As you can see, there are some very apparent and some not-so-apparent qualities and difficulties with both selections. A wonderfully balanced link building service plan then, should probably include aspects of both. Do what you are able yourself and carefully delegate pieces of your plan that you simply can’t do all by yourself. Once you learn this, you’re certainly on your journey to higher rankings.
